Description
The Neon Tetra (Paracheirodon innesi) is one of the most popular and iconic freshwater fish in the aquarium hobby, known for its vibrant, iridescent blue and red coloration. Native to the clearwater and blackwater streams of the Amazon Basin in South America, particularly in Brazil, Colombia, and Peru, this small, peaceful fish adds a brilliant splash of color to any aquarium.In the wild, Neon Tetras inhabit slow-moving, densely vegetated waters with soft, acidic conditions and dim lighting due to overhanging foliage. They are omnivorous, feeding on small invertebrates, algae, and organic matter.In aquariums, Neon Tetras thrive in a well-planted tank with subdued lighting, a soft substrate, and plenty of hiding spots created with driftwood, rocks, and plants to mimic their natural environment. They are schooling fish and should be kept in groups of at least six, as this helps reduce stress and encourages natural, synchronized swimming behavior. They are peaceful and do well with other small, non-aggressive tankmates such as Corydoras, dwarf gouramis, and other small tetras.Growing to about 3-4 cm (1.5 inches), Neon Tetras are perfect for small to medium-sized aquariums. Their stunning colors, peaceful nature, and active schooling behavior make them a favorite choice for both beginner and experienced aquarists, especially in community and planted tanks.
Additional information
Nature | Peaceful |
---|---|
Grown Size (max) | 3cm |
Temp Range | 22-27 |
pH | 6.0-7.5 |
Tank Size Required (min) | 40L |
Diet | Omnivore |
Approx Purchase Size | 2cm |
Level of Care Required | Easy |
